Radical Prostatectomy Combined with Prostate Specific Membrane Antigen–radioguided Lymph Node Dissection is Associated with Longer Treatment-free Survival for Patients with Primary Lymph Node–positive Prostate Cancer
We looked at whether a technique to label and detect lymph node metastases during prostate cancer surgery is linked to better cancer control for patients whose preoperative scans showed limited spread to the lymph nodes. We found that this approach may lead to better cancer control after surgery and a longer time before additional treatment is needed.
